What is Social Champ
Social Champ is a social media management tool used to plan, schedule, publish, and recycle posts across multiple social networks from a single interface. It targets small businesses, agencies, and creators that need consistent publishing, basic collaboration, and performance reporting without adopting a broader marketing suite. The product emphasizes post scheduling workflows (including queues and recurring content), multi-account management, and lightweight analytics. It also supports content curation and integrations intended to streamline day-to-day social publishing.
Multi-network scheduling and queues
Social Champ supports scheduling and publishing workflows designed for frequent posting across multiple social profiles. Queue-based scheduling and recurring/recycling options help teams maintain an always-on content calendar. These capabilities align with common requirements for SMBs and agencies that prioritize operational efficiency over full-funnel marketing automation.
Content recycling and evergreen posts
The platform includes features to re-share or recycle evergreen content, reducing manual effort for long-running campaigns. This is useful for brands that rely on repeatable promotional or educational posts and want consistent cadence. Compared with broader marketing platforms, this focuses specifically on social publishing continuity rather than cross-channel journey orchestration.
Team collaboration for SMBs
Social Champ provides collaboration-oriented workflows such as managing multiple brands/accounts and coordinating publishing activities. This fits small teams and agencies that need basic role separation and review processes. It can serve as a dedicated social layer alongside other tools rather than requiring a full marketing suite migration.
Limited enterprise governance depth
Organizations with complex approval chains, granular permissions, and audit requirements may find the governance model less comprehensive than enterprise-focused platforms. Advanced compliance features (for regulated industries) are typically more limited in SMB-oriented social tools. Larger teams may need additional process controls outside the product.
Analytics less comprehensive than suites
Reporting is generally oriented toward social performance and publishing outcomes rather than end-to-end attribution across channels. Teams that need deeper competitive intelligence, media monitoring, or unified marketing analytics may require separate tools. This can increase tool sprawl for organizations seeking a single system of record.
Marketing automation not a core focus
While it supports social publishing and basic campaign execution, it is not positioned as a full marketing automation platform. Use cases such as multi-step lead nurturing, advanced segmentation, and cross-channel orchestration typically require dedicated marketing automation software. Buyers evaluating an all-in-one growth platform may find gaps outside social.
Plan & Pricing
| Plan | Price | Key features & notes |
|---|---|---|
| Free | $0 / month | 3 social accounts, 15 scheduled posts, 1 user. (Get started) |
| Starter | $5 per social account/month (monthly) — $4 per social account/month (billed yearly at $48/yr) | Unlimited post scheduling; 1 user; 1 workspace; Bulk scheduling (300 posts); Social Inbox; Analytics & reporting; Start 7-day free trial (no card). Discounted extra profiles: after 20 profiles, additional profiles = $5/account. |
| Growth | $9 per social account/month (monthly) — $8 per social account/month (billed yearly at $96/yr) | Unlimited post scheduling; Unlimited users; Unlimited workspaces; Advanced analytics & reporting; Social Listening; Post approval workflows; Priority support; Start 7-day free trial (no card). Volume pricing: discounts after 20 accounts (per-site note in KB). |
| Enterprise | Custom / Book a demo | Custom pricing: Unlimited users, workspaces, advanced analytics, SSO, API access, dedicated support, white-label reports. Contact sales / book demo. |
Notes: Pricing model is per-social-account (per-profile). Free plan and 7-day free trials for paid tiers are offered per the vendor's pricing page and help docs.
